Transfer Students
This page is designed to walk a student through the Transfer Credit Center's website. The pictures below can be enlarged by clicking on the picture.
 
 
To determine if a course at your home institution has an equivalent course here at UMCP, you can click the Transfer Course Lookup link, the first one in the left navigational pane  
 
The website will give you two options: search for all courses at your home institution or a course by course search. If you desire to search for all courses and equivalencies for your home institution, click the first button, called CompleteSearch  
 
You can enter the full name of your institution or part of the name to search for schools. Clicking submit will generate a list of schools that match your query.  
 
Once the search has generated a list of schools, click on your school's name.  
 
By selecting your school's link the website will display all courses and equivalencies. For example, Montgomery College's EE150 is equivalent to UMCP's ENEE150.  
 
You'll notice that some courses have footnotes. If you click on the particular footnote the website will display all the footnote codes and their explanations.  
 
If you are looking for a course to satisfy the UMCP's general education requirement you can see that if a course meets a general education requirement it is noted in the display. For example, EC201 at Montgomery College is equivalent to UMCP's ECON201. This course is an SB (social and behaviorla science) course in the general education.  
 
If you have a current schedule at your home institution & want to see which courses on your schedule have equivalencies at UMCP, you can use the Course-by-Course method on the Transfer Credit Center's website  
 
If you decide to use the Course-by-Course Search instead of the CompleteSearch you will still enter your school's name to generate a list of schools that match.  
 
The system will generate the list. To continue, just select your school's name.  
 
Once you select your school's name, you can enter the courses you are taking or are considering taking at your current institution to determine equivalencies.  
 
The website will generate a chart that displays your schedule at your home institution, any UMCP equivalencies, if UMCP will accept that course credit, and if the course meets general education requirements.  
 
If you need additional information, you can click the Transfer Info link, the fifth link on the left navigational pane, on the Transfer Credit Center's homepage.  
 
The website will display several options for students curious about the process, other polices, and frequently asked questions.
